How they compare

France currently reports 27,827 one-year-olds against 26,583 one-year-olds in Liberia, a difference of 1,244 one-year-olds.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 16 shared years of data; in 2008 it was Liberia ahead.

France ranks 68th and Liberia ranks 69th of 191 countries.

Liberia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
